2017-02-13 5 views
0

장치에 TOBY-L2 시리즈 (L210) Ublox 모듈을 사용하고 있습니다. 다중 세그먼트 SMS (800 바이트)를 보내려고하는데 몇 세그먼트가 전송 된 후 (3 * 160 바이트) 나에게 CMS ERROR: 100이 전송됩니다. 코드 : 100은 사양에 따라 '알 수 없음'이므로 명확하지 않습니다.다중 분할 SMS로 인해 Ublox에서 CMS를 리턴합니다. ERROR : 100

참고 : 모뎀은 서비스 제공 업체의 3G에 등록되어 있습니다.

다음 AT 명령이 응답하지 않으며 나머지 SMS 세그먼트를 보낼 수 없습니다. 내가 통신하는 데 사용하는 완전한 AT 로그를 첨부하고 있습니다. 나는 그런 오류가 발생되는 이유는 무엇

다음

  1. 에 제발 도와주세요?
  2. 이 오류에서 모뎀을 복구하고 나머지 통신을 수행하는 방법 또는이 상황을 방지 할 수있는 방법이 있습니까? 로그 AT

우리가 발견 한 "솔루션"는 마지막 메시지 (단지 AT+CGMS=<len>가 사용)하지만 모든 AT+CMMS=1;+CGMS=<len>을 사용하고, 10 초를 추가하는 것이 었습니다

AT+CFUN=15 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
OK 
AT+CPIN? 
+CME ERROR: 100 
AT+CPIN? 
+CPIN: READY 
OK 
+CREG: 4 
+UREG: 0 
+CIEV: 9,1 
+CIEV: 9,1 
+CIEV: 12,2 
+CREG: 0 
+CIEV: 9,1 
+CIEV: 12,1 
AT+CPIN? 
+CPIN: READY 
OK 
ATE0 
OK 
AT+CREG=1 
OK 
AT+CMEE=1 
OK 
AT+CMER=1,0,0,2,1 
OK 
AT+CTZU=1 
+CREG: 0 
AT+UREG=1 
OK 
AT+CREG? 
+CREG: 1,0 
OK 
AT+UREG? 
+UREG: 1,0 
OK 
AT+CGSN 
354455181246191 
OK 
AT+CGMR 
15.63 
OK 
AT+CCID 
+CCID: 34560181111123406763 
OK 
AT+CNMI=1,1 
OK 
AT+CMGL=4 
OK 
AT+CFUN=1 
+CIEV: 2,4 
+CIEV: 8,0 
+CIEV: 5,0 
+CIEV: 8,0 
+CIEV: 5,0 
+CIEV: 8,0 
+CIEV: 5,0 
+CIEV: 8,0 
+CIEV: 5,0 
OK 
+CIEV: 2,2 
+CREG: 0 
+CREG: 1 
+CIEV: 3,1 
AT+UDOPN=4 
+UDOPN: 2,"ABCD Mobile" 
OK 
AT+UDOPN=0 
+UDOPN: 0,"500:002" 
OK 
AT+COPS=2 
+CIEV: 9,2 
OK 
+CREG: 0 
+CIEV: 3,0 
+UREG: 0 
+CIEV: 9,1 
AT+URAT=2 
OK 
OK 
AT+COPS=0 
OK 
+CREG: 2 
+CIEV: 2,3 
+CIEV: 2,2 
+CREG: 1 
+CIEV: 3,1 
+UREG: 3 
+CIEV: 9,2 
AT+CREG? 
+CREG: 1,1 
OK 
AT+UREG? 
+UREG: 1,3 
OK 
AT+CREG? 
+CREG: 1,1 
OK 
AT+UREG? 
+UREG: 1,3 
OK 
AT+CREG? 
+CREG: 1,1 
OK 
AT+UREG? 
+UREG: 1,3 
OK 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
AT+CREG? 
+CREG: 1,1 
OK 
AT+UREG? 
+UREG: 1,3 
OK 
+CIEV: 2,3 
+CIEV: 2,2 
AT+CREG? 
+CREG: 1,1 
OK 
+CIEV: 2,3 
+CIEV: 2,2 
AT+UREG? 
+UREG: 1,3 
OK 
AT+CCLK? 
+CCLK: "17/02/13,15:54:39+44" 
OK 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
+CIEV: 2,3 
+CIEV: 2,2 
AT+CREG? 
+CREG: 1,1 
OK 
+CIEV: 2,3 
+CIEV: 2,2 
AT+UREG? 
+UREG: 1,3 
OK 
+CIEV: 2,3 
+CIEV: 2,2 
AT+CMGS=154 
> 
00D1000B911654219561F10000FFA005000324060162B219AD66BBE17230574C36A3D56C375C0EE68A8162B219AD66BBE17230574C36A3D56C375C0EE68A8162B219AD66BBE17230574C36A3D56C375C0EE68A8162B219AD66BBE17230574C36A3D56C375C0EE68A8162B219AD66BBE17230574C36A3D56C375C0EE68A8162B219AD66BBE17230574C36A3D56C375C0EE68A8162B219AD66BBE172▒ 
+CMGS: 175 
OK 
AT+CMGS=154 
> 
00D1000B911654219561F10000FFA005000324060260AE986C46ABD96EB81CCC1503C564335ACD76C3E560AE986C46ABD96EB81CCC1503C564335ACD76C3E560AE986C46ABD96EB81CCC1503C564335ACD76C3E560AE986C46ABD96EB81CCC1503C564335ACD76C3E560AE986C46ABD96EB81CCC1503C564335ACD76C3E560AE986C46ABD96EB81CCC1503C564335ACD76C3E560AE986C46ABD96E▒ 
+CMGS: 176 
OK 
AT+CMGS=154 
> 
00D1000B911654219561F10000FFA00500032406037039982B068AC966B49AED86CBC15C31D98C56B3DD7039982B068AC966B49AED86CBC15C31D98C56B3DD7039982B068AC966B49AED86CBC15C31D98C56B3DD7039982B068AC966B49AED86CBC15C31D98C56B3DD7039982B068AC966B49AED86CBC15C31D98C56B3DD7039982B068AC966B49AED86CBC15C31D98C56B3DD7039982B068AC966▒ 
+CMS ERROR: 100 

답변

1

(전송 및 수신) 각 메시지 사이의 지연.

문제를 Ublox에 신고 했으므로 문제를 해결할 수 있습니다.

+0

감사합니다. Aldrian. 나는 이것을 UBlox에보고했고 디버그 로그를 요청했다. 우리는 h/w에 약간의 변경을해야했고 일부 gpios에서 출력을 캡처해야했습니다. 정보를 사용하고 고치기를 바랍니다. +1을보고 해 주셔서 감사합니다. – SajithP

+1

문제는 최신 펌웨어 (L1010의 경우 A01.50)로 수정되었습니다 – Aldrian

+0

해결되었다고 들었습니다. :) – SajithP